#8f679d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f679d is composed of 56.1% red, 40.4%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.9% cyan, 34.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 284.4 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 51%. #8f679d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#1f003b.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#8f679d color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#8f679d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f679d has RGB values of R:143, G:103,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 9398173.

Shades and Tints of #8f679d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f679d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867a8a is the less saturated color, while #bd07fd is the most saturated one.
